Abstract
A driver including boost circuitry for reducing tri-state delay. Boost circuitry includes boost legs ( ) and ( ) having boost delay chains ( ) and ( ), respectively. Subcircuits ( ) and ( ) may include a series of inverters or other devices to delay a tri-state enable signal (EN ) or (EN BAR) for a predetermined amount of time substantially equivalent to the time it takes for a first signal (A ) to travel from input pin A to PAD. Transient current provides a boost by discharging or charging output nodes (G ) and (G ), respectively. Boost legs ( ) and ( ) remain on for the length of time it takes for enable signal (EN ) or (EN BAR) to travel through subcircuits ( ) and ( ). The boost increases the rate of transition of output nodes (G ) and (G ) thereby reducing the delay of tri-state signal (EN ).
